INDIA chill deepens, Akhilesh slams ‘chirkut’ Cong UP chief, accuses party of ‘cheating’ SP

SP president says Kamal Nath and Digvijaya kept his leaders waiting till 1 am when they went for seat-sharing talks, accuses them of being in cahoots with BJP

Amid rising tension between the Opposition INDIA bloc allies, the Congress and the Samajwadi Party (SP), over the collapse of their alliance talks for the Madhya Pradesh Assembly elections, SP president Akhilesh Yadav Thursday accused the Congress of having “cheated” his party.

Akhilesh’s statement came soon after UP Congress chief Ajay Rai asked his party to withdraw from the MP fray in favour of the grand old party, saying the SP did not have any base there.

Rai also said that as an INDIA bloc partner the SP should rally behind the Congress if it wants to fight the ruling BJP in MP.
